Cinemark, which saw box office momentum buoy second quarter financials, said August and September will be tougher as new release volume dips. CEO Sean Gamble told Wall Street on a post-earnings call that the nation’s third largest exhibitor is optimistic on the business, but that the pace of an ongoing recovery depends on consumer sentiment

HBO Max and Discovery+ will officially merge in summer 2023. Warner Bros. Discovery announced the news during the company’s quarterly investor call on Thursday afternoon.
